GoFundHer-com is a financial platform for girls and women to connect with sponsors worldwide.

Your supporters can sponsor you one-time or set up monthly sponsorship to you for as low as $1.

GoFundHer-com delivers premium financial services in 200+ countries and is working to change the world for girls and women.

GoFundHer-com and City Girls Big Dreams are sister companies with teams dedicated to the lives of girls & women. Learn more about them at CityGirlsBigDreams-com.

The mission of GoFundHer-com and City Girls Big Dreams is to eliminate inequality for women by holding space for economic success through a real and sustainable financial platform designed by women, for women.

Businesses and Non-Profit organizations can also receive monthly sponsorships with a free GoFundHer-com account.

8 Best Patreon Alternatives & Competitors For 2023 (Comparison)
Kickstarter is probably the most well-known crowdfunding platform in the world. It’s a good alternative to Patreon if you’re trying to raise money for one-time creative endeavors, but it doesn’t support memberships, so it’s not suitable for collecting recurrent donations.
11 Patreon Alternatives for Audience Monetization in 2023
This concept makes Kickstarter more suited for creators who want to fund a big project rather than foster a community or make content long term.
Source: www.uscreen.tv
12+ Brilliant Patreon Alternatives to Monetize Your Audience
Kickstarter helps breathe life into projects. It’s ideal for films, music, arts, theaters, games, comics, designs, photography, and so on.
6 Patreon Alternatives for Your Startup in 2019
Kickstarter is a global crowdfunding site that started in 2009. Like Patreon, there are plenty of Kickstarter competitors on the market, but it still boasts over 16.3 million backers and $4 billion in pledges.
Source: sumup.com
10 Best Patreon Alternatives
Kickstarter is a more exclusive platform compared to Patreon, so small-time creators may want to carefully consider this before they join. However, it has had more than 186,000 projects successfully funded by the end of 2019 and more than $5.1 billion in pledges, making it a worthy alternative to Patreon.
